MS Access VBA循环查询和重命名文件

时间:2017-12-18 16:07:21

标签: vba ms-access access-vba

我的查询包含两个字段,“发件人”和“收件人”。 from和to保存包含我要重命名的文件的完整文件路径的数据。如何循环查询并实际重命名文件?这是我的代码,但它不起作用:

Dim rs As DAO.Recordset
 Dim db As Database
 Dim strSQL As String

 Set db = CurrentDb

 strSQL = "select * from qryImagesToRename"

 Set rs = db.OpenRecordset(strSQL)

 Do While Not rs.EOF

    Name .Fields("From") as .Fields("To")

    rs.MoveNext
Loop

我哪里错了? - 我收到一个编译错误“预期的用户定义类型,而不是项目”,它突出显示以下行:

Dim db As Database

1 个答案:

答案 0 :(得分:0)

你错过了记录集对象:

INSERT INTO table1 (id, fill)
select id, replace(fill, '@@@@', '    ') from table2